Summary: AssertionError executing authz stmt on UDF without
keyspace

Performing a {{GRANT}} or {{REVOKE}} on a user defined function requires the
function name to be qualified by its keyspace. Unlike {{GRANT/REVOKE}} on a
table, the keyspace cannot be inferred from the {{ClientState}} as it's needed
by the parser to either lookup the function (in 2.2), or convert the function
arguments from CQL types to their corresponding {{AbstractType}} (in 3.0+).
Currently, performing such a statement results in an unhandled assert error and
a {{ServerError}} response to the client.
